WebWhat challenges does the lack of gravity pose for astronauts? In the absence of gravity there is no weight load on the back and leg muscles, so they begin to weaken and shrink. In some muscles degeneration is rapid, and without regular exercise astronauts may lose up to 20 percent of their muscle mass within 5-11 days. WebNov 16, 2015 · It is mind-boggling to comprehend that one hour can pass by on one planet while seven years pass by on Earth. The explanation comes down to what scientists call Gravitational Time Dilation. WebGravity is a force of attraction that exists between any two masses, any two bodies, any two particles. Gravity is not just the attraction between objects and the Earth. It is an attraction that exists between all objects, everywhere in the universe. Sir Isaac Newton (1642 -- 1727) discovered that a force is required to change the speed or ...
